A few days ago, someone claimed to have taken a photo of the "Monster-Suppressing Pagoda" in West Lake, Hangzhou. According to the photo, it should be in the evening, the light strips on Leifeng Pagoda have been lit, and the clouds above Leifeng Pagoda There is a "pagoda" in it, and what's even stranger is that the "pagoda" is also glowing, very bright.

Many people think it is a mirage phenomenon, but after analysis, it is found that it is just the reflection of the rear view from the glass mirror. The so-called "demon-suppressing pagoda" is actually the Baochu Tower behind the viewer. When the front of the glass is not very bright, it is very It is easy to reflect the bright landscape behind. If you don’t believe it, try it.

While everyone was talking about the "Monster-Suppressing Pagoda" incident in West Lake, Hangzhou, another strange scene appeared in the sky in Haikou, Hainan: a "castle in the air" appeared out of thin air on the cloud-shrouded sky, like an ancient palace. Seeing this The strange scene evokes many people's memories of the journey to the west.

A few days ago, someone claimed to have taken a photo of the

Obviously, this is a mirage phenomenon that is guaranteed to be fake. Why are you so sure? Because at this time, Haikou, Hainan indeed has all the natural conditions to produce a mirage phenomenon.

First, north of Haikou is the Qiongzhou Strait with a width of about 30 kilometers. The 30 kilometers of water is enough to refract light and bend the light that travels in a straight line. Across the Qiongzhou Strait is the Leizhou Peninsula in Guangdong, and far across from Haikou is Xuwen County in Zhanjiang.

In 2019, a mirage of "ancient buildings" appeared in Hongze Lake, Jiangsu. Many people speculated that it might be a confusion of time and space. Later, someone found the original scene in Laozishan Town, southwest of Hongze Lake. Laozi Mountain There are many ancient buildings in the town, Anhuai Zen Temple, Bagua Tower, etc. Laozishan Town is about 20 to 30 kilometers away from the viewer.

Tuesday, July is in the hot summer, and the air temperature is much higher than the sea temperature. According to the latest water temperature data provided by CDAS, the surface water temperature of the sea areas near Hainan is about 29°C. The temperature of some more mobile sea areas may be lower, but in Hainan The maximum temperature exceeds 33℃, sometimes even higher.

The air near the sea level is affected by the temperature of the sea water, and the temperature must be lower. When the air temperature at high altitude is greater than the air temperature near the sea level, the light will be refracted, and the light will bend downward, sending the invisible landscape to our eyes. , so a "castle in the air" mirage will appear in the sky.

Based on the principle of mirage generation, we boldly speculate that the original scene of the "castle in the sky" mirage in Haikou, Hainan should be in Xuwen County across the Qiongzhou Strait, relatively close to the private houses on the shore of the Qiongzhou Strait. According to the style of the "castle in the sky" , should be the roofs of a row of low-rise buildings.

Have you noticed that the "castle in the sky" mirage looks very huge, its size is several times larger than the nearby buildings, let alone the original scene dozens of kilometers away. The question is, why is the mirage? Is it many times bigger than the distant view?

This has to start with the perspective of the human eye and the refraction of light. The size of things we see with our eyes is determined by the size of the perspective. For the same object, the closer the distance, the larger the perspective. The larger the object seen by the eyes, the farther the perspective. The smaller it is, the smaller the object the eye sees.

Under normal circumstances, the angle of view of an object very far away is very small, and it looks very small, like the tip of a needle. Therefore, based on the position of the viewer, the original scene of the mirage is located several 10 kilometers away, and it is impossible to see it. Yes, even if you could see the original scene with your own eyes, it would be extremely small.

Why is the mirage many times larger than the original scene? This is because when light propagates in air with uneven density, it is bent due to refraction, which is equivalent to a natural " convex lens ". After bending, the viewing angle of the mirage is much larger than the original viewing angle.

I believe many people know the principle of convex lens. A convex lens can refract light, and the light emitted through the convex lens is bent. If the convex lens is made of glass, the refractive index is about 1.5. The convex lens brings the flat line light to a point, which is It is called "focus", and the distance from the convex lens to the focus is called the focal length. There is no fixed value for the focal length, which is related to the material and thickness, but it is generally about 10 centimeters.

Convex lenses can play the role of "magnification". Within the focal length of the convex lens, you can see the enlarged upright virtual image of the object. Beyond the focal length, you can see the enlarged inverted image. This is because the convex lens magnifies the virtual image perspective of the object. The larger the virtual image angle of view is, the larger the virtual image we will see.

Light bends in the air. Its principle is similar to the "convex lens principle", which magnifies the virtual image perspective of the object. Therefore, the mirage we see is obviously several times the size of the original scene. If the mirage were not magnified many times, No matter how good our eyesight is, it is impossible to see the "mirage" phenomenon.
